His Highness Sheikh Mohammed Bin Rashid Al Maktoum, UAE Vice President, Prime Minister, and Ruler of Dubai, has approved the establishment of the Artificial Intelligence and Data Authority.
This new strategic move intends to unite public data, artificial intelligence, and digital government capabilities, combining them into a single national ecosystem, as the UAE government prepares for the next phase of AI-powered digital transformation.
Sheikh Mohammed affirmed that the UAE is committed to creating a more efficient, agile, and proactive global government model that uses data and artificial intelligence to make decisions, improve government services, and improve people’s quality of life, thereby increasing the country’s competitiveness and global leadership in the digital economy.
Sheikh Mohammed stated, “Today, we approved the establishment of the Artificial Intelligence and Data Authority, the single national body responsible for data, artificial intelligence, and digital government in the UAE, reporting directly to the Cabinet.” Omar Sultan Al Olama will head the Authority. Our vision is for a government that is faster, smarter, and constantly one step ahead, one that uses technology to serve people and create a better future for the next generation.
Sheikh Mohammed stated, “We are constructing the government of the future. A government that relies on data and agentic AI. One that makes faster decisions, offers better results, and never stops improving. A government based on people, not papers.
